Area contextNeighborhood Overview – The Billiards Training Company (Cheverly, MD)
Cheverly, Maryland, is a well-established community situated just east of Washington, D.C., offering a convenient base for regional activities. The Billiards Training Company is centrally located within Cheverly, with direct access from major thoroughfares like Kenilworth Avenue (MD-201) and the Baltimore-Washington Parkway (MD-295). This proximity makes it easily reachable from various parts of the Washington metropolitan area. Driving in, participants often use I-495 (the Capital Beltway) to connect to these main routes. Parking is generally available directly at the facility, though it can become more limited during peak training hours or special events. For those flying in,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port (BWI) is the closest major airport, typically a 20-30 minute drive away depending on traffic.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port (DCA) is also accessible, usually within a 25-40 minute drive. Public transportation options are available, with Metrobus routes serving Cheverly Avenue, connecting to nearby Metrorail stations, although direct transit to the facility itself may require transfers. Rideshare services are a reliable alternative for getting directly to the training center. Smart arrival tactics involve planning your route to account for potential rush hour traffic, especially if arriving during weekday mornings or late afternoons from the D.C. or Baltimore directions.

National Arboretum
The U.S. National Arboretum is a vast green oasis offering a diverse collection of plant collections, historic structures, and scenic landscapes. It's an excellent place for a contemplative walk, photography, or simply enjoying nature away from the intensity of training. Key features include the National Capitol Columns and various themed gardens. Plan for at least an hour or two to explore its extensive grounds. It's a relatively short drive and provides a significant change of scenery and pace, ideal for unwinding or for companions looking for activities.

Weather & Seasons at The Billiards Training Company
- Winter: Winter in Cheverly is cool to cold, with average daytime temperatures ranging from the high 30s to low 40s Fahrenheit. Pack layers, including a warm coat, scarf, and gloves, for any time spent outdoors. Indoor training venues will be heated, but transit to and from the facility will require adequate winter attire. Snow is possible, though usually not disruptive for extended periods.
- Spring & early summer: Spring and early summer bring pleasant, warming temperatures, generally ranging from the 50s to 70s Fahrenheit. This is an ideal time for comfortable outdoor activities and exploring parks. Lightweight jackets or long-sleeved shirts are usually sufficient for cooler mornings and evenings. As summer approaches, temperatures begin to climb, so lighter clothing is recommended for outdoor breaks.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er in Cheverly is characterized by warm to hot and humid conditions, with daytime temperatures often reaching the 80s and 90s Fahrenheit. Light, breathable clothing such as shorts, t-shirts, and sundresses are appropriate. Staying hydrated is crucial, and taking advantage of indoor, air-conditioned spaces like the training facility is common. Outdoor activities are best planned for cooler morning or late afternoon hours.
- Fall season: Autumn brings a refreshing change with cooler, crisp air, typically ranging from the 50s to 60s Fahrenheit. This season is very comfortable for both indoor and outdoor activities. Pack sweaters, light jackets, and long pants. The foliage can be beautiful, making short walks or visits to nearby parks particularly enjoyable before the colder weather sets in.
- Rain & snow: Rain is possible throughout the year, with heavier amounts often occurring in spring and summer. Thunderstorms are common during warmer months. Winter can bring snow, usually light to moderate. Always check the forecast before traveling and have an umbrella or waterproof jacket handy. Any significant snow events could impact travel times, so building in extra buffer for arrival is wise during winter months.
